WebPustules are smaller than 5–10 mm, and filled with pus, that is, purulent material composed of inflammatory cells ( neutrophils ). Pus can indicate bacterial, fungal or viral infection. Some pustules are sterile and are due to inflammatory skin disease. This topic provides a differential diagnosis of pustular skin conditions. WebIntertrigo is a common inflammatory skin condition that is caused by skin-to-skin friction (rubbing) that is intensified by heat and moisture. It usually looks like a reddish rash. Trapped moisture, which is usually due to sweating, causes the surfaces of your skin to stick together in your skin folds. WebErythema multiforme is a skin disorder that's considered to be an allergic reaction to medicine or an infection. Symptoms are symmetrical, red, raised skin areas that can appear all over the body. They do seem to be more noticeable on the fingers and toes. WebErythroderma is defined as erythema that covers more than 70% of the body surface area. WebJul 15, 2024 · Erythema multiforme is caused by a cell-mediated immune response, and infections are associated with 90% of cases. 6 Although herpes simplex virus (HSV) type 1 is the most commonly identified ...
